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kent House to Fishbourne (Sussex) start from £35.80 one way, or £35.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kent House to Fishbourne (Sussex) are available for £38.20 one way, or £39.00 return

The station, though modest in size, provides essential services for its patrons. The ticket office operates during the week from early morning until evening and has ticket machines available, ensuring passengers can secure their travel tickets with ease. Those utilizing smartcard services will find them supported here, along with collection facilities for online purchases. For persons with hearing impairments, induction loops are installed, enhancing communication efficiency.

Access and Assistance

Kent House might not boast step-free access, reflecting certain challenges for passengers with mobility needs. However, assistance can be arranged ahead of time to bridge these gaps, while the station staffing hours ensure help is available when most needed. Despite the absence of toilets and refreshment facilities, travelers will find strategically placed seating and waiting rooms to rest while waiting for their trains.

Seamless Transport Connections

Intermodal transport is a strong suit of Kent House. With designated bus stops—Beckenham Road Bus Stop BL and BA—ensuring connectivity towards Herne Hill and Beckenham Junction, the station provides convenient alternate routes on days of disruption. While parking facilities are absent, cyclists can benefit from the available bicycle stands, making it an eco-friendly stop in your journey.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The facilities at Fishbourne (Sussex) Station are straightforward. There isn't a ticket office, but ticket machines are readily available, allowing you to collect tickets you’ve purchased online. For those traveling with a Disabled Persons Railcard, the machines support your needs. Although the station prioritizes accessibility—offering induction loops and assistance points wherever possible—the station terrain involves steep ramps and narrow platforms that might pose challenges.

For those planning longer journeys, please note the absence of wa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ities. While there is a seating area for a brief pause, this station is mainly designed for quick passages rather than lingering stays. The good news is, the station is fitted with CCTV for added safety, and staff from nearby stations can offer assistance, though it is advised to pre-book this whenever possible. With no dedicated parking or bicycle storage, alternative arrangements would need to be considered if you're bringing a vehicle or bike.
